AI Summary
DPL LLC reported a net income of $100 million for the second quarter of 2025, a 10% increase from $90 million in the same period of 2024. Rev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2025, reached $1.2 billion, up 5% from $1.14 billion in the prior year. The company's strategic outlook emphasizes continued investment in infrastructure, with capital expenditures projected to increase by 8% to $325 million in 2025. Key business changes include the successful integration of new energy efficiency programs, contributing an additional $15 million in revenue during the quarter. Risks highlighted in the filing include regulatory uncertainties and fluctuating commodity prices, which could impact future profitability. DPL LLC also noted a decrease in its accumulated other comprehensive income by $5 million due to changes in cash flow hedges during the second quarter of 2025. The company's equity stood at $2.5 billion as of June 30, 2025, reflecting stable financial health.

Glossary
- Accumulated Other Comprehensive Income
- A component of shareholders' equity that includes unrealized gains and losses on certain investments, foreign currency translation adjustments, and pension plan adjustments. (Decreased by $5 million in Q2 2025 due to changes in cash flow hedges, impacting the overall equity picture.)
- Cash Flow Hedges
- Financial instruments used to offset the risk of changes in cash flows related to a specific exposure, such as interest rate or currency fluctuations. (Changes in these hedges led to a $5 million decrease in DPL LLC's Accumulated Other Comprehensive Income during the second quarter of 2025.)
